We Offer: You will be part of the Transported by Maersk Platform Portfolio focused on streamlining and automating container shipping operations through advanced software solutions. Our software products are used by customers, Maersk's operations front-line staff, and vendors assisting with Maersk's operations across the globe. We aim to reduce manual processes to a minimum and enable automated planning and execution of operational decisions.
You will join one of our highly capable product teams, with members in India and Denmark and work closely with business and technology colleagues to build the analytical backbone of our equipment management application enabling the business to optimize the use and flow of empty containers around the globe. As a Data Engineer, you will be building, maintaining, and operating our data and analytics products in collaboration with other team members. You will be taking part in architectural discussions, and actively engaging with stakeholders from both business and technology to align expectations and remove roadblocks. Dedicated product managers will work with you to convert business needs into technology solutions.
We believe in empowering teams and individuals to make the right technology choices, supported by architectural guardrails that align with Maersk's technology strategy and cyber security practices.
We use modern engineering practices, do pair-programming, and take on the full DevOps responsibility for what we build. We primarily use technologies such as Python, Pandas, Spark, Databricks and Kafka, rely heavily on open source and build software we deploy using GitHub Actions and Docker onto Kubernetes clusters, operated in the Microsoft Azure cloud.
